句无忧

在线教程:一步步教你如何使用违禁词检测API!

时间:2024-12-08 07:45
来源:网络整理
句无忧

在线教程:一步步教你如何使用违禁词检测API,确保内容安全无忧!

在当今互联网信息爆炸的时代,内容创作与传播已成为各类网站、自媒体及电商平台不可或缺的重要环节。然而,在信息流通的同时,如何确保内容不含违禁词,避免法律及平台规则风险,是每个创作者必须面对的问题。本文将提供一份详尽细致的教程,一步步教你如何高效使用违禁词检测API(应用程序接口),为你的内容安全保驾护航。

一、违禁词检测的重要性

违禁词,即违反国家法律法规、社会公德、平台规定等内容的词汇或短语。在创作过程中,一旦不小心使用了这些词汇,可能导致内容被删除、账号被封禁,甚至面临法律追究。因此,使用专业的违禁词检测工具,可以有效降低这种风险,保障内容的合规性和安全性。

二、选择合适的违禁词检测API

当前市场上存在众多违禁词检测服务,选择合适的API是第一步。以下几点是选择时需要考虑的关键因素:

  • 准确性API是否能准确识别并标记出所有潜在的违禁词,避免误报和漏报。
  • 更新频率:鉴于违禁词库可能随时间变化,API的更新频率直接决定了其时效性和实用性。
  • 易用性API接口的友好程度、文档清晰度、技术支持的响应速度等,都会影响使用效率。
  • 价格与服务:根据自身需求选择合适的付费模式,同时关注服务商提供的售后服务和技术支持。

三、注册与获取API Key

在确定合适的违禁词检测API服务后,接下来是注册账号并获取API Key。以下是具体步骤:

  1. 访问服务商官网:通过搜索引擎或直接访问推荐的服务商网站。
  2. 注册账号:填写个人或企业的基本信息,完成邮箱验证,部分服务商可能还需进行实名认证。
  3. 创建应用/项目:登录后,在控制台中创建一个新的应用或项目,用于管理API的使用权限。
  4. 获取API Key:在创建的应用/项目详情页,可以找到API Key或生成新的访问令牌。请务必妥善保管,避免泄露。

四、整合API至你的平台或应用

获取API Key后,即可开始将其整合到你的网站、APP或其他内容创作工具中。具体步骤如下:

  1. 阅读API文档:服务商提供的API文档是集成工作的基础,需仔细阅读了解API的功能、请求格式、响应格式及错误处理等细节。
  2. 选择编程语言和框架:根据你的技术栈选择合适的编程语言和框架,如Python、Java、Node.js等,以及前端的AJAX、Fetch等网络请求方式。
  3. 编写API请求代码
    • 构建请求URL和参数:按照文档说明,设定请求地址、HTTP方法(GET/POST)、Headers(包含API Key)、Body(如文本内容)。
    • 发送请求并处理响应:使用http请求库发送请求,获取服务器返回的JSON数据。通常,响应中会包含检测到的违禁词列表及位置信息。
  4. 错误处理:添加必要的错误处理机制,如网络故障、API访问限制、超时等异常情况的处理逻辑。
  5. 结果显示:根据业务需求,将检测结果显示在用户界面上,如高亮显示违禁词、给出修改建议等。

五、实例操作与优化建议

为便于理解,以下以Python为例,展示一个简单的集成实例:

import requests
import json

# 假设API服务的基础URL和API Key已定义
API_BASE_URL = 'https://api.example.com/check'
API_KEY = 'your_api_key_here'

# 待检测的内容
content_to_check = "这是一段包含可能违禁词汇的文本。"

# 构建请求Headers和Body
headers = {'Content-Type': 'application/json', 'Authorization': f'Bearer {API_KEY}'}
body = {'text': content_to_check}

# 发送请求
response = requests.post(API_BASE_URL, headers=headers, data=json.dumps(body))

# 解析响应
if response.status_code == 200:
    result = response.json()
    if result['status'] == 'success':
        bad_words = result['bad_words']
        for word in bad_words:
            print(f"发现违禁词: {word['word']}, 位置: {word['position']}")
    else:
        print("检测失败:", result['message'])
else:
    print(f"请求错误: {response.status_code}, 信息: {response.text}")

优化建议

  • 批量检测:对于大量内容,考虑实现批量检测功能,以减少API调用次数,提高效率。
  • 缓存机制:对于频繁检测且结果变化不大的内容,可引入缓存机制,减少不必要的API调用。
  • 动态更新:定期检查API文档,确保集成代码与服务端接口保持一致,及时更新API Key或调整请求参数。

六、结语

通过以上步骤,你已经能够成功地将违禁词检测API集成到你的平台或应用中,为你的内容创作和管理提供强有力的支持。随着内容审核需求的日益增强,持续优化和完善这一功能,不仅能够提升用户体验,还能有效规避法律风险,助力你的业务稳健发展。在选择和使用API的过程中,始终关注其准确性、更新频率、易用性及性价比,让技术赋能内容,创造更大的价值。

句无忧
这篇关于《在线教程:一步步教你如何使用违禁词检测API!》的文章就介绍到这了,更多行业资讯、运营相关内容请浏览句无忧行业动态。更多热门创作工具:违禁词检测、AI文案、文案提取、视频去水印、伪原创等,可前往句无忧网使用!
热点
热门工具
体验句无忧微信小程序
微信扫一扫,随时随地检测
热点
热点资讯
重磅功能上线!支持团队会员和API接口,助力企业高效管理与智能检测!

这两项新功能的推出,将为企业提供更加高效、便捷的违禁词检测服务,助力企业轻松应对内容合规挑战。

六部门发文!预制菜明确不许添加防腐剂!

近日,市场监管总局等六部门联合印发《关于加强预制菜食品安全监管 促进产业高质量发展的通知》(以下简称《通知》),首次在国家层面明确预制菜范围,对预制菜原辅料、预加工工艺等进行界定,并提出大力推广餐饮环节使用预制菜明示,保障消费者的知情权和选择权。

关于规范公众号文章诱骗点击小程序骗取广告收益行为的公告

近期,平台发现部分创作者在文章中使用不完全或擦边的标题、擦边的封面和无意义或不完整的内容,并插入诱导性小程序卡片、图片、文字链接,引导用户点击跳转至无关或无效页面进行广告诱骗点击。这种违规导流行为损害用户的阅读体验,骗取广告收益,严重扰乱了平台的健康生态。

【最新】上海出台化妆品行业广告宣传合规指引

市市场监管局介绍,为推进本市化妆品产业健康规范发展,发挥广告对化妆品品牌建设的作用,日前,上海市市场监管局、上海市药品监管局根据《广告法》《化妆品监督管理条例》等法律法规以及化妆品广告监管执法实践,联合制定出台《上海市化妆品行业广告宣传合规指引》。

警惕!这5批次不合格化妆品

日前,北京市药品监督管理局按照《北京市2023年药品(含药包材)、医疗器械、化妆品质量抽查检验工作实施方案》,组织对全市化妆品生产环节(含注册人、备案人、境内责任人)及互联网开展了监督抽检工作,共完成监督抽检1600批。现将已核查过的5批次不合格产品(详见附件)予以公告。